White Water Rafting on the Pacuare River - The Pacuare River is rated one of the top rivers in the world. You’ll experience the intimate nature of the rainforest via the river. The warm water, cascading waterfalls, and opulently lush rainforest with its brilliantly colored plants, animals, and birds make this trip exquisite for your senses.
Located on Costa Rica's Atlantic slope, the Pacuare River borders the Talamanca mountain range, home to native Cabecar Indians and an incredible variety of wildlife, including parrots, toucans, deer, jaguars, ocelots, monkeys, butterflies, and more. Add in the exciting Class III -IV whitewater rapids and you have a tropical adventure packed with rich experiences that last long after you’ve returned home. You'll raft from San Martin to Siquirres for 14 miles on exciting Class III-IV whitewater.

Mountain Bike to Monteverde - Bicycling as a means of transport between La Fortuna and Monteverde. People who love to ride mountain bikes can now do so as a means of transport up to Monteverde – do an adventure on the way to your next destination, as a part of the innovative Desafío Adventure Connection. We have two riding options, depending on your adventure level: The first and more-intense ride is about 3-hours long or about 25 miles. We’ll start at the Lake Arenal Dam where you drop off your luggage with Captain Marquez, our boat driver. From there we ride past the rural community of El Castillo until we get to the pristine Caño Negro river that runs alongside Rancho Margot. From here we do a technical river crossing and continue riding through rolling hills along the edge of picture-perfect Lake Arenal until ride to the small town of Río Chiquito. We also offer, a slightly-more-expensive, but shortened, 15-mile ride that includes a boat ride across the Lake Arenal to the mid-way point.
This man-made lake is the second-largest lake in Central America. To get from one side of the lake to the other by land, there are several bridge-less river crossings. The scenery is a combination of secondary rainforest, farmland and great views of the lake and volcano.

SkyTram – SkyTrek – SkyWalk – 3 amazing tours for you to enjoy. SkyTrek - Sky Trek is a system of zip lines ranging from mountain to mountain, which together have a distance of 2.5 miles of linear cable.The tour gives you the opportunity to fly through a cable and have a unique experience of adventure and adrenaline at speeds up to 40 miles per hour with distances ranging up to 2500 feet and heights of 524 feet. In addition the tour offers 5 observation towers that exceed the cloud forest treetops providing a panoramic view. All with total security and in an innovative braking system.The tour starts with the Sky Tram that will lead you up to the Continental Divide.
- SkyWalk - Learn in the cloud forest Sky Walk is a guided tour, which combines trails and suspension bridges with lengths of even 984 feet and heights above the canopy of Monteverde cloud forest. The tour gives you the opportunity to enjoy the flora and fauna of the area, always joined by one of our specialized guides. The tour lasts between 2 and 2.5 hours.Sky Walk reunites all the conditions of security and confidence. The bridges have been adapted even for people with some disability.
- Hidden Valley Night Tour - Located near the Cerro Plano area between Santa Elena and the Monteverde Reserve the Hidden Valley trail offers the ideal forest and elevation to view the incredible wildlife of the tropics. For those who wish to observe wonders hidden in the forest after dark, we offer guided night hikes. The tour begins just before nightfall, allowing us to see a wide variety of nocturnal creatures. The walk starts at 5:30 pm after enjoying the beautiful sunset guests will be amazed the forest seems to awaken during the transition to night. The naturalist guide will explain many of the unique features of the forest and creatures that inhabit it while navigating the trails, the tour ends at 7:30 P.M. The Hidden Valley organization is committed to seeing protected areas like Hidden Valley Trail carry on forever in hopes of guaranteeing a better quality of life for future generations. At that time when founder David Savage acquired 11 hectares of the tropical forest much of the surrounding land was being converted to farming however the Savage family resisted and decided to protect it, preserving it into what is today Hidden Valley Trail.

Snorkeling at Tortuga Island - Cruising along the coast for a breathtaking 50-minute boat ride is how you’ll begin your voyage to Tortuga Island. Jagged volcanic rock spills into the sea to create a dramatic contrast with the brown sand, red rocks and crushed shells that make up the variety of different beaches along the way.
Spotting a group of playful dolphins, marveling at the enormous jumping manta rays or for the luckiest of visitors, catching a glimpse of surfacing humpback whales are just a few examples of the marine life frequently viewed as we make our way to the island.
Upon arriving to the tropical paradise of Tortuga Island we anchor the boat within viewing distance of the white sand beach for our first snorkeling session. The crystal waters at Tortuga are surrounded by volcanic rock reef which is home of the best snorkeling site on Costa Rica’s Central Pacific coast. King Angelfish, Porcupine fish, Morays, Needlefish, Spotted Eagle Rays and a myriad of other tropical beauties make for a phenomenal snorkeling experience. Not to mention the oysters your guide might find for a fresh ceviche on the beach!
